Altria Group, Inc. (NYSE:MO) Shares Sold by South Dakota Investment Council

South Dakota Investment Council reduced its holdings in Altria Group, Inc. (NYSE:MOFree Report) by 2.2% during the 4th quarter, Holdings Channel reports. The firm owned 214,521 shares of the company’s stock after selling 4,800 shares during the quarter. South Dakota Investment Council’s holdings in Altria Group were worth $11,217,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

Altria Group Trading Up 1.2 %

MO stock opened at $55.01 on Friday. The company has a market capitalization of $93.22 billion, a PE ratio of 8.40, a P/E/G ratio of 2.89 and a beta of 0.64. Altria Group, Inc. has a 12-month low of $39.25 and a 12-month high of $58.03. The business’s fifty day moving average price is $52.61 and its 200 day moving average price is $52.73.

Altria Group (NYSE:MOGet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, January 30th. The company reported $1.29 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$1.28 by $0.01. Altria Group had a negative return on equity of 258.72% and a net margin of 46.90%. Research analysts predict that Altria Group, Inc. will post 5.32 EPS for the current fiscal year.

Altria Group Announces Dividend

The firm also recently disclosed a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Friday, January 10th. Stockholders of record on Thursday, December 26th were given a dividend of $1.02 per share. The ex-dividend date was Thursday, December 26th. This represents a $4.08 annualized dividend and a dividend yield of 7.42%. Altria Group’s dividend payout ratio is currently 62.29%.

About Altria Group

(Free Report)

Altria Group, Inc, through its subsidiaries, manufactures and sells smokeable and oral tobacco products in the United States. The company offers cigarettes primarily under the Marlboro brand; large cigars and pipe tobacco under the Black & Mild brand; moist smokeless tobacco and snus products under the Copenhagen, Skoal, Red Seal, and Husky brands; oral nicotine pouches under the on! brand; and e-vapor products under the NJOY ACE brand.
